Velo3D, Inc. (NYSE: VLD) waa hormuudka shirkad tignoolajiyada wax soo saarka biraha ah ee qaybaha muhiimka ah.Waxay haysataa budada superalloy ee nikkel ku salaysan Amperprint ® 0233 Haynes ® 282 ® daabacadaha taxanaha ah ee Sapphire . si ay u bixiyaan xoogga sare ee gurguurta, xasiloonida kulaylka, weldability iyo workability in aan caadi ahayn in Alloys kale sex.Maaddadu waxay aad ugu habboon codsiyada qaab-dhismeedka heerkulka sare sida tamarta tamarta, marawaxadaha gaaska iyo gawaadhida meel bannaan, oo loo isticmaali karaa in soo saar kuwa kulaylka beddela, dab-dejiyayaal, tuubooyin, dahaarka gubashada, matoorada gantaallada, iyo mashiinnada daboolan.

Dahaarka gubanaya ee ka samaysan Amperprint® 0233 Haynes® 282® budada Höganäs ah
Daabacaha ugu horreeya ee Sapphire ® isticmaalaya Amperprint ® 0233 Haynes ® 282 ® budada waxaa ku shaqeyn doona Duncan Machine Products (DMP), oo ah shirkad qandaraasle ah oo fadhigeedu yahay Duncan, Oklahoma. Nidaamkani wuxuu noqon doonaa kan toddobaad ee DMP's Velo3D Sapphire ® taxanaha daabacaha.
"Hadafkeena Velo3D waa inaan awood u siinno injineerada inay dhisaan qaybaha ay rabaan iyagoon wax u dhimin naqshadeynta ama tayada," ayuu yiri Benny Buller, maamulaha iyo aasaasaha Velo3D. "Isticmaalka biraha cusub ee budada ah sida Amperprint ® 0233 Haynes ® 282 xalal ilaa-dhamaadka waxay sii ballaadhinaysaa fursadaha tignoolajiyada wax-soo-saarka wax-soo-saarka.La-hawlgalayaasheena Höganäs waxay bixiyaan agabka ugu tayada sarreeya, waxaanan rajaynayaa inaan arko waxa ay macaamiisheena u isticmaalaan daawaha cajiibka ah si ay u sameeyaan.
Nikkel-ku-salaysan budada ah, sida Amperprint ® 0233 Haynes ® 282 ®, ayaa badanaa loo isticmaalaa in lagu daabaco qaybaha codsiga heerkulka sare sababtoo ah iska caabintooda dildilaaca iyo awoodda ay ku shaqeeyaan heerkulka u dhow barta dhalaalka. Alloys in loo isticmaalo in vacuum, balasmaha, iyo codsiyada kale ee dalbanaya. Its alxanka sare ka dhigaysa budada ku haboon qaybo ka mid ah nidaamyada waaweyn sababtoo ah waxaa lagu alxan karaa qaybaha kale.
Höganäs waxay ku takhasustay soo saarista budada wax-soo-saarka wax-soo-saarka wax-soo-saarka, iyadoo bixisa alaabooyin leh qaab wareegsan oo isku mid ah, kiimikaad si adag loo kontoroolo, dheecaannada la xoojiyay.

Velo3D waa mid ka mid ah shirkadaha tiknoolajiyada wax soo saarka ugu horreeya si ay u siiyaan budada Amperprint ® 0233 Haynes ® 282 ® macaamiisheeda. Qaar badan oo ka mid ah macaamiisha Velo3D waxay isticmaalaan xalalkeeda dhamaadka-ilaa-dhamaadka si ay u soo saaraan qaybo loogu talagalay duulista, tamarta, saliidda iyo gaaska, meel bannaan iyo Codsiyada kale ee waxqabadka sare leh, taas oo ka dhigaysa budadani mid ku habboon galka alaabta Velo3D.Marka lagu daro Amperprint ® 0233 Haynes ® 282 ® budada, budada birta ah ee lagu daabici karo tiknoolajiyada Velo3D waxaa ka mid ah Hastelloy X ®, Inconel 718, aluminium F357, Ti 6Al-4V Fasalka 5 iyo dhowr qalab oo kale.
Velo3D waa shirkad tignoolajiyada daabacaadda 3D. Daabacaadda 3D (sidoo kale loo yaqaan wax-soo-saarka wax-soo-saarka (AM)) waxay leedahay awood gaar ah si loo hagaajiyo habka qaybaha birta qiimaha sare leh loo soo saaro. Si kastaba ha ahaatee, tan iyo markii la abuuray ku dhawaad ​​​​30 sano ka hor, awoodaha biraha dhaqameed ee AM ayaa si weyn loo xaddiday.Tani waxay ka hortagtaa tignoolajiyada in loo isticmaalo si loo abuuro qaybaha ugu qiimaha badan iyo saameynta leh, xaddidaya isticmaalkeeda meelo gaar ah oo xayiraadaha la aqbali karo.
Velo3D waxay ka gudubtaa xaddidaadahan, sidaas darteed injineeradu waxay naqshadeyn karaan oo daabacan karaan qaybaha ay rabaan. Xalalka shirkadu waxay sii daayaan xoriyado kala duwan oo naqshadeyn ah, awood u siinaya macaamiisha dhinacyada sahaminta hawada, hawada hawada, koronto, tamarta, iyo semiconductors si ay u cusbooneysiiyaan mustaqbalka. Isticmaalka Velo3D, macaamiishani hadda waxay dhisi karaan qaybo bir ah oo muhiim ah kuwaas oo markii hore aan suurtogal ahayn in la soo saaro. Xalka dhamaadka-ilaa-dhamaadka waxaa ka mid ah Flow ™ printer diyaarinta software, daabacayaasha taxanaha Sapphire ® iyo nidaamka ilaalinta tayada ee Assure ™- Dhammaan kuwaas oo ay taageerayaan Velo3D's Intelligent Fusion ® habka wax soo saarka. Shirkaddu waxay bixisay nidaamkeedii ugu horreeyay ee Sapphire ® ee 2018 waxayna ahayd lamaane istaraatiijiyadeed oo shirkado hal-abuur leh sida SpaceX, Honeywell, Honda, Chromalloy, iyo Lam Research.Velo3D ayaa la doortay. galay liiska shirkadda Fast ee sumcadda leh ee 2021 ee shirkadaha ugu hal-abuurka badan adduunka.
